Working within our established Energy Networks and Renewable team, you will be responsible for undertaking earthing design studies and measurements ensuring the compliance and safety of substation operatives. You will also be involved in completing Electric and magnetic field (EMF) calculations, Electromagnetic Interference studies, and lightning protection. Reporting to an Associate Technical Director, you will be responsible for the delivery of project-related tasks to meet budget and contributing towards the achievement of the divisional business plan. As part of your role, you will be responsible for conducting risk analysis of the plan and identifying potential threats and risks. Using your expertise in Electrical Earthing you will make recommendations on potential mitigation for any issues identified, or work with stakeholders to agree actions. The role requires a certain level of flexibility to visit site locations across the UK.
Role accountabilities:
- Provide specialist earthing design engineering and solutions for clients using the CDEGS software suite.
- Earthing system measurements of substations up to 400 kV AC, HVDC system, and other EHV AC installations including overhead line towers, cable sealing ends compounds, and cable joint bays.
- Electric and magnetic field (EMF) calculations for EHV substation, cables, and overhead lines.
- Lightning protection system design.
- Electromagnetic Interference studies and mitigation design.
- Project management of multiple earthing design projects to ensure they remain within budget and timescale constraints.
- Work in collaboration with the Arcadis substation detailed design team to ensure the integrity of the overall design.
- Lead the creation of competitive proposals/quotations for new packages of work.
- Provide leadership and technical advice to junior project team members to support them in their delivery of the project and in their professional development.
Qualifications & Experience:
- Have a BSc/BEng/ BEng (Hons) or MSc/MEng or equivalent in a relevant discipline.
- Achieved Chartered or Incorporated Engineer professional status, or equivalent or working towards this.
- Have previous relevant experience including supervision of elements of large, complex projects.
- Working knowledge of earthing system measurements.
- Substantial experience in earthing system analysis using the software package CDEGS.
- Suitable experience of earthing issues and standards associated with power networks up to 400 kV.
- Ability to communicate complex technical or commercial issues to peers or senior managers.
- Ability to develop working relationships quickly and effectively.
- Experience in writing clear and concise documentation.
- Flexibility to travel both in the UK and overseas.
